What makes it The Goods?  If you're a shortboarder you’re always looking for a board that can span a range of conditions and provide a high level of performance that isn’t too far out of reach. And if you’re new to shortboards you want a board that will give you confidence while not being too difficult to ride.
 

A combination of the best features from some of our most popular and proven designs, The Goods is one of the most versatile boards we have in our lineup. Its moderate nose width and rocker maintains paddling while keeping swing weight down for sharp vertical turns. The Goods has an outline that leans more towards a subtle glide for smaller waves. while still being narrow enough for vertical surfing in waves with a little juice. The tail rocker is kept fairly low for speed and glide which helps immensely when dealing with slower sections found in softer waves or needing to create speed immediately in waves with tight pockets and a bit of punch.
